  1. Neglecting Bankroll Management
    One of the most critical aspects of successful betting is effective bankroll management. Many bettors fail to set a budget or establish guidelines for how much they are willing to risk. This oversight can lead to impulsive betting and significant losses. To avoid this mistake, create a clear bankroll management plan that outlines your total betting budget and the maximum amount you are willing to stake on individual bets. A common rule is to wager no more than 1-5% of your total bankroll on a single bet, ensuring that you can withstand losing streaks without depleting your funds.
  2. Chasing Losses
    Chasing losses is a common emotional reaction that can lead to poor decision-making. When bettors experience a string of losses, they may feel compelled to increase their stakes or place desperate bets in an attempt to recover their losses quickly. This approach often results in further losses and can lead to a destructive cycle. To avoid chasing losses, it’s essential to stick to your betting strategy and remain disciplined. Accept that losses are part of the betting experience, and focus on making rational, informed decisions rather than reacting impulsively to short-term setbacks.
  3. Betting with Emotion Instead of Logic
    Many bettors allow their emotions to dictate their wagering decisions, which can lead to costly mistakes. This emotional betting often occurs when individuals place wagers on their favorite teams or players, disregarding statistical analysis and relevant information. To counteract this tendency, it’s crucial to approach betting with a logical mindset. Conduct thorough research, analyze data, and rely on facts rather than personal biases when making betting decisions. Creating a betting strategy based on logic and reason will enhance your chances of success and minimize the influence of emotions.
  4. Ignoring Line Shopping
    Line shopping refers to the practice of comparing odds across multiple sportsbooks to find the best value for your bets. Many bettors overlook this essential step, settling for less favorable odds without realizing that even a small difference in odds can significantly impact long-term profitability. To avoid missing out on better opportunities, always compare odds before placing a bet. Use betting comparison websites or apps to easily track and evaluate odds across various platforms, ensuring you secure the best possible value for your wagers.
  5. Failing to understand Betting Odds
    A lack of understanding of betting odds is another common mistake that can lead to poor wagering decisions. Bettors who do not comprehend how odds work may misinterpret the likelihood of outcomes or fail to identify value in certain bets. It’s essential to familiarize yourself with different odds formats (decimal, fractional, and moneyline) and understand how they correlate with implied probabilities. Additionally, learning to calculate the potential payout for different bets will enhance your decision-making process and enable you to spot favorable opportunities.
  6. Not Staying Informed About Relevant Factors
    Successful betting requires staying informed about various factors that can influence outcomes, such as team injuries, weather conditions, and player performance trends. Many bettors make the mistake of placing wagers without considering these critical variables, leading to uninformed decisions and avoidable losses. To mitigate this risk, dedicate time to research and gather information relevant to the events you plan to bet on. Follow sports news, analyze statistics, and monitor trends to ensure you have a comprehensive understanding of the context surrounding your bets.
